QUALITY OF LIFE RELATED TO HEALTH IN PEOPLE WITH COVID-19, INTERNED IN A HOSPITAL ESTABLISHMENT IN CALLAO

Objective: To determine the quality of life related to health in people with COVID-19, admitted to a hospital in Callao.
Materials and methods: This study was prepared from a quantitative approach perspective and its methodological design was descriptive and cross-sectional. The population consisted of 72 patients. The data collection technique was the survey and the instrument was the EUROQOL questionnaire, structured by 5 items and 5 dimensions.
Results: Regarding quality of life, those with a medium level predominate with 58.3% (n=42), followed by a high level with 22.2% (n=16) and a low level with 19.4. % (n=14). According to its dimensions, in mobility, those who do not have problems walking predominate with 55.6% (n=40), in personal care, those who do not have problems predominate with 55.6% (n=40), in daily activities, those who have some problems predominate with 51.4% (n=37), in discomfort pain, those who have moderate pain predominate with 70.8% (n=51), in anxiety depression, 41 participants representing 56 .9% are moderately anxious or depressed.
Conclusions: Regarding the quality of life, those with a medium level predominate, followed by a high level and a low level. According to their dimensions, in mobility, those who have no problems with walking predominate, in personal care, those who have no problems predominate, in daily activities, those who have some problems predominate, in pain and discomfort, those who have pain predominate. moderate, in anxiety depression, those who are moderately anxious or depressed predominate.
